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Buff-bellied Hummingbird | lesser yellow underwing |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Apodiformes (Apodiformes)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Trochilidae | Noctuidae |
| Genus | Amazilia | Noctua |
| Species | Amazilia yucatanensis | Noctua comes |
Evolutionary Relationship
Buff-bellied Hummingbird and lesser yellow underwing share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
